A benefit for Joe Lopez, former vocalist and co-founder of Grupo Mazz, will take place at Far West San Antonio on Thursday, June 16.

RELATED: Prison letter from Joe Lopez surfaces online

The event was announced on Far West San Antonio’s official Facebook page that the club received exclusive right and honor to present the first Joe Lopez benefit dance.

“We will be supporting the legend thru his parole appeal and ask you to join us for this one night of special and close friends playing all his hits,” the club posted.

Entrance into the event is a $10.00 donation to see more than 10 artists supporting the cause. According to the flyer, artists scheduled to attend include Chente Barrera, David Faris, David Marez, Gary Hobbs, Ram Herrera, Sunny Sauceda, Los Desperadoz and more. Far West San Antonio is located at 2502 Pleasanton Road.

Lopez was convicted in 2006 on multiple sex offense charges involving a minor. He was sentenced to 32 years in prison, but because he will serve the sentences concurrently, they amount to 20 years in prison. His full prison term would end on October 27, 2026. He is eligible for parole on October 26, 2016.
